Master budgeting, accounting, and charging to track service costs accurately and provide transparency to the business.
Learn to forecast, analyze, and influence service demand patterns to optimize capacity and reduce costs during off-peak times.
Master the lifecycle of the Service Portfolio (Pipeline, Catalogue, Retired), ensuring services align with strategy and resource availability.
Acquire the skills to perform SWOT analysis, understand service economics, and define the unique value proposition of IT services.
Deepen your understanding of ITIL Service Strategy definition including utility, warranty, and the four service assets (management, organization, process, knowledge).
Understand the strategic role of BRM in ensuring business needs and service offerings are constantly aligned.

This is an Intermediate Lifecycle module.
ITIL Foundation Certificate: You must hold the ITIL Foundation Certificate in IT Service Management.
Required Training: Completion of a minimum of 21 contact hours (3 days) of formal, accredited ITIL Service Strategy Certification training is mandatory.
Recommended Experience: At least 2 years of professional experience working in an IT service management or strategic planning environment is highly recommended.
